Wood window service encompasses a range of professional solutions aimed at maintaining, repairing, or restoring wooden window components. These services often include tasks such as replacing rotted or damaged wood, refinishing surfaces to restore their appearance, and addressing issues with window frames, sashes, and hardware. Skilled service providers focus on ensuring that wooden windows are functional, aesthetically pleasing, and properly sealed to prevent drafts or water intrusion. Regular maintenance and timely repairs can extend the lifespan of wood windows, helping property owners preserve the character and value of their buildings.
One of the primary problems addressed by wood window services is deterioration caused by exposure to moisture, pests, or age. Over time, wood can warp, crack, or rot, leading to compromised window integrity and reduced energy efficiency. Service providers can identify early signs of damage and perform necessary repairs or replacements to prevent further issues. Additionally, these services often include weatherproofing and sealing to improve insulation, reduce energy costs, and prevent drafts. Properly maintained wood windows can also enhance the overall curb appeal of a property by maintaining their original charm and craftsmanship.

The overview below groups typical Wood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Dearborn,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Replacement Costs - Replacing a wood window typ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size and style. For example, a standard double-hung window may cost around $500 to replace. Costs vary based on window dimensions and design complexity.
Repair Expenses - Repairing wood windows can cost between $150 and $600 per window, covering tasks such as sash repair or frame restoration. Minor fixes like reglazing might be closer to $150, while extensive repairs could approach $600.
Refinishing Prices - Refinishing or stripping wood windows generally falls within $200 to $700 per window, depending on the condition and extent of work needed. A basic sanding and staining job might be around $200, whereas more detailed refinishing could be higher.
Installation Service Fees - The cost for professional installation of wood windows ranges from $200 to $800 per window. This includes labor and materials, with larger or custom windows tending toward the higher end of the spectrum. Costs may vary based on local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
